Question
In which of the following sites of the Harappan civilization the terracotta models of plough have been discovered?
Options
Kalibangan and Dholavira
Shortughai and Lothal
Banawali and Cholistan
Sanghol and Rakhigarhi
MCQ
Advertisements
Solution
Banawali and Cholistan
Explanation:
Terracotta models of ploughs have been found at Harappan sites such as Banawali in Haryana and the Cholistan region, showing that plough-based farming was practiced in these areas.
